Cómo realizar la normalización de bases de datos y por qué

Es importante analizar cuidadosamente el impacto de las técnicas de desnormalización en la integridad de los datos y sopesar los beneficios frente a los riesgos potenciales. Recuerde que la desnormalización debe usarse con prudencia, ya que puede introducir complejidad adicional, aumentar los requisitos de almacenamiento y afectar la coherencia de los datos. La dependencia multivaluada (multivalued dependency) o multivalor tiene lugar siempre que dos atributos sin relación curso de análisis de datos entre sí, dependan del mismo atributo. Es mucho más sencillo mantener las bases de datos que ya tienes y realizar nuevos añadidos. También es más rápido conectar las fuentes de datos a cualquier sistema interno o externo, pues no serán necesarias revisiones para asegurar que los datos enviados son correctos. Esto significa que el nivel 1, o 1NF, es la forma más básica y simple de normalizar bases de datos, hasta alcanzar la más sofisticada de todas, o 5NF.

1 Primera Forma Normal

El inconveniente de este diseño es que cada vez que se registre un nuevo artículo para un cliente, también será necesario incluir el código postal, de modo que habrá datos redundantes. Para ello, se ha de fragmentar la tabla de tal manera que no presente ninguna dependencia o, al menos, solo dependencias multivaluadas triviales. Crearemos , entonces, dos tablas separadas, lo cual es posible porque el número de artículo y el código postal no están relacionados. Ten en cuenta que no siempre es posible evitar por completo los valores duplicados en las bases de datos relacionales. Volviendo a nuestra base de datos, se puede observar que la conexión de tablas con claves ajenas puede estar ligado a redundancias. Una tabla crucial en nuestra base de datos es la Posición del ítem, puesto que revela qué artículos se incluyen en cada factura y cuántas unidades se han pedido.

Valores tendencia

En DEYDE contamos con una amplia gama de posibilidades para que no te tengas que preocupar por la gestión de los servicios Contamos con experiencia y conocimiento en calidad de datos para aportar a tu empresa la mejor solución posible. Estamos a tu disposición si buscas una herramienta de garantías para ir un paso por delante. Hayvarias herramientas de deduplicación que te permiten eliminar esos datosredundantes que no son necesarios. Descubre casos reales y beneficios que revolucionan la toma de decisiones empresariales.

Tercera forma normal

  • Descubre cómo puedes facilitar el desarrollo de una aplicación usando frameworks.
  • A grandes rasgos, se trata de organizar los datos en una base de datos de manera sistemática y eficiente.
  • Las bases de datos es uno de los conceptos más importantes en el mundo de la programación, y hay todo un mundo por descubrir, en esta ocasión hablaremos de la normalización de bases de datos.
  • Te estarás preguntando si todo este esfuerzo vale la pena para normalizar una base de datos.

Entonces, para definir la normalización de una base de datos diremos que es una técnica aplicada durante el Diseño Lógico con el objeto de optimizar la estructura de los datos de un sistema de información en el modelo relacional. La normalización https://despertarperu.com/ganar-un-salario-por-encima-del-promedio-entrar-en-el-mundo-de-los-datos-con-el-bootcamp-de-tripleten/ clasifica los datos, hace que una base de datos sea fácil de gestionar y aumenta su eficiencia. Además, reduce la redundancia de datos y elimina anomalías, lo que permite evitar errores, garantizar la consistencia e integridad de datos.

Estas plataformas manejan diversos aspectos de la gestión de bases de datos para sus usuarios, al mismo tiempo que abstraen y simplifican el diseño de la base de datos. En este caso, creamos una nueva tabla para relacionar el nombre de la fábrica con su código, y también eliminamos las relaciones de dependencia entre atributos no clave de la tabla original. Las dependencias transitivas podrían evitarse si se escindiera la primera tabla en las tablas Unidades y Proveedor, de forma que no se encontrara https://ciudademprendedores.com/mexico/ganar-un-salario-por-encima-del-promedio-entrar-en-el-mundo-de-los-datos-con-el-bootcamp-de-tripleten/ ninguna clave candidata que se superpusiera a otra. Dada la dependencia entre número de proveedor y proveedor, no se ajusta a la FNBC. El atributo número de proveedor tiene dependencia transitiva de la clave candidata compuesta por proveedor y número de artículo y el atributo proveedor de la clave candidata compuesta por número de proveedor y número de artículo. El almacenamiento y mapeo de datos es más lógico y, por tanto, redobla su utilidad para los departamentos que empleen las tablas.

Evita anomalías en los datos

que es la normalización en base de datos